-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Note——九月十月百度人搜,阿里巴巴,腾讯华为小米搜狗笔面试五十题整理
一个单词单词字母交换,可得另一个单词,如army-mary,成为兄弟单词。提供一个单词,在字典中找到它的兄弟。描述数据结构和查询过程。线程和进程区别和联系。什么是“线程安全”线程和进程区别和联系见文档《进程线程区别与联系.doc》如果你的代码所在的进程中有多个线程在同时运行,而这些线程可能会同时运行这段代码。如果每次运行结果和单线程运行的结果是一样的,而且其他的变量的值也和预期的是一样的,就是线程安全的。 线程安全问题都是由全局变量及静态变量引起的。 若每个线程中对全局变量、静态变量只有读操作,而无写操作,一般来说,这个全局变量是线程安全的;若有多个线程同时执行写操作,一般都需要考虑线程同步,否则就可能影响线程安全。C和C++怎样分配和释放内存,区别是什么注意: new、delete返回的是某种数据类型指针,malloc、free返回的是void指针。T(n) = 25T(n/5)+n^2的时间复杂度 对于T(n) = a*T(n/b)+c*n^k;T(1) = c 这样的递归关系,有这样的结论:if (a b^k) T(n) = O(n^(logb(a)));logb(a)b为底a的对数if (a = b^k) T(n) = O(n^k*logn);if (a b^k) T(n) = O(n^k);a=25; b = 5 ; k=2a==b^k 故T(n)=O(n^k*logn)=O(n^2*logn)T(n) = 25T(n/5)+n^2 = 25(25T(n/25)+n^2/25)+n^2= 625T(n/25)+n^2+n^2 = 625T(n/25) + 2n^2= 25^2 * T( n/ ( 5^2 ) ) + 2 * n*n= 625(25T(n/125)+n^2/625) + 2n^2= 625*25*T(n/125) + 3n^2= 25^3 * T( n/ ( 5^3 ) ) + 3 * n*n= ....= 25 ^ x * T( n / 5^x ) + x * n^2T(n) = 25T(n/5)+n^2T(0) = 25T(0) + n^2 == T(0) = 0T(1) = 25T(0)+n^2 == T(1) = 1x = lg 5 n 25 ^ x * T( n / 5^x ) + x * n^2= n^2 * 1 + lg 5 n * n^2= n^2*(lgn)链表克隆。链表的结构为:?? ? ?typedef struct list {?? ? ? ? ?int data; //数据字段?? ? ?list *middle; //指向链表中某任意位置元素(可指向自己)的指针?? ? ?list *next;//指向链表下一元素?? ? ?} list;?求正整数n所有可能的和式的组合(如;4=1+1+1+1、1+1+2、1+3、2+1+1、2+2)?#includestdio.h#defineLEN 20intpath[LEN];intarr[LEN] = {1, 1, 1, 2, 2, 3, 4, 4, 5, 5, 5, 8, 8, 8, 10, 10, 10, 12, 12, 12};voidclearpath(){inti;for (i = 0; i LEN; i++){path[i] = 0;}}voidout_put(){inti;for (i = LEN-1; i = 0; i--){if(path[i] == 1)printf( %d , arr[i]);}printf(\n);}/*算法:**q(n, t)表示从arr[0]...arr[n]中选出和为t的子集,则**q(n, t) = q(n-1, t-arr[n]) + q(n-1, t)*/voidq(intn, intt, intflag){if(t 0)return;path[n+1] = flag;if(n == 0){if(t == 0){path[n] = 0; //不包含arr[0]out_put();}elseif(arr[n] == t){path[n] = 1;//包含arr[0]out_put();}}else{q(n-1, t-arr[n], 1); //包含arr[n]q(n-1, t, 0); //不包含arr[n]}}voidsubsum(intlen, intt){q(len - 1, t - arr[len], 1);q(len - 1, t, 0);}intmain(){intt = 20;clearpath();subsum(LEN - 1, t);system(pause); return 0;}求旋转数组的最小元素(把一个数组最开始的若干个元素搬到数组的
您可能关注的文档
最近下载
- 24张安全目视化:流程图、管理检查要点.pptx VIP
- 2024北京广渠门中学初一(上)期中道德与法治试题.docx VIP
- 2025中级经济师《经济基础知识》三色笔记.pdf VIP
- GB/T 17215.321-2021电测量设备(交流) 特殊要求 第21部分:静止式有功电能表(A级、B级、C级、D级和E级).pdf
- Kollmorgen电机AKD驱动器手册中文版.pdf VIP
- 河南省九师联考2024-2025学年高一上学期11月期中考试地理试卷(含答案).pdf VIP
- 河南省九师联盟2024-2025学年高一上学期期中考试历史试题(含答案).pdf VIP
- 日立电梯MCA13中文注释版电气原理图.pdf
- 财务总监培训战略成本管理-战略成本管理.ppt VIP
- 战略成本管理 .pdf VIP
原创力文档


文档评论(0)